What is Chefs?
Established in 2003, Chefs, now operating as Gorji, has carved a niche in the fine dining and culinary products market. The company is recognized for its Mediterranean food offerings, date night experiences, and cooking technique classes taught by Chef Gorji. It has garnered accolades, including being named "Best Restaurant In Addison" by EATER Dallas in 2017 and receiving recognition for "One of the Best Steaks In the metroplex (Dallas, TX)" by the Dallas Observer in 2016. Gorji is also a two-time Texas Steak Cook-off Champion. Beyond its restaurant operations, the company has successfully launched Gorji Gourmet Sauces, available at Whole Foods, and published the award-winning "Zing! By Gorji" cookbook. The company has strategically evolved, including a remodel in 2010 and adopting a no-tipping policy in 2016, positioning itself as an innovative player in the hospitality industry.
